They created the bomb. Then created its story.

Eighty years after the devastating atomic bombings that ushered in the nuclear age, Bombshell explores how the U.S. government manipulated the narrative about the atomic bombings of the Japanese cities Hiroshima and Nagasaki. Through propaganda, censorship and the co-opting of the press, the government presented a benevolent picture of atomic power, minimizing the horrific human toll. Bombshell sheds light on the efforts of a group of intrepid reporters to let the world know the truth.


Main Cast: Ann Curry

Director: Ben Loeterman

Writer: Ben Loeterman

Editors: Matt Shelley-Reade, Peter Rhodes

Cinematographers: Stephen McCarthy, Jason Longo
